## Releases

Release 2.14.1 addresses the query planner regression introduced in 2.14.0, where the Marrowdb planner chose sequential scans for indexed range predicates on the Saltgrove shard. If you are on-call and see latency alerts on read replicas, confirm the running version before escalating; 2.14.0 should be rolled back immediately. All release artifacts are signed and must be verified before deployment, using the key that follows.

deploy key for kajof-fajop: bky6_gDHw9Q

Visitor policy — evacuation-chair store, Deverill Tower night shift. The evacuation-chair store on Level 5 must remain unobstructed at all times; visitors may not be shown inside except during a drill or genuine emergency. Night-shift wardens are responsible for the weekly chair check and for logging any seal breaks. Visitors present during an evacuation follow their escort to the refuge point; they never operate the chairs themselves. The store door is keypad-locked, and the warden access code is below.

turnstile pass: bdg-FVNQRS-72965873

Welcome to the Lanternleaf consent banner program. Plugin authors must register each banner variant before rollout so the Driftgate compliance checker can validate copy, locale coverage, and dismissal behavior. Please test against the staging consent ledger rather than production; consent records are immutable once written, and malformed entries cannot be purged without a formal review. To connect your local plugin harness to the staging ledger, configure your client with the connection string below.

replica DSN, hadug-yajep: postgresql://aldiel_svc:W4u8z42Jo5IFtG@db-1656.torvacorp.local:5432/holael